Incorrect bed design wastes space and invites condensation; that leads to damp mattresses, awkward layouts and repeat fixes.

Common Challenges

  • Small vans lose storage to poor bed designs

    A badly planned platform can block access to under-bed storage and reduce usable space, leaving touring gear piled up and hard to reach.

  • Mattresses that trap moisture on Wolds tours

    Exposed hill winds and long rural runs can increase condensation; trapped moisture shortens mattress life and raises mould risk on tours.

  • Convertible mechanisms that jam or fail

    Complex slide or hinge systems can bind after heavy use or rough lanes, leaving you without a reliable bed when touring.

About This Service

About this Service

Design and fit of sleeping platforms and convertible beds for vans used in the Lincolnshire Wolds and AONB lanes. Suits countryside tourers who need compact, secure sleeping arrangements for narrow, hilly routes.

Rural lanes and chalk-hill terrain favour low-profile or modular bed systems that keep vehicle height suitable for farm gates and tree-lined lanes. Securing points, anti-shift fixings and vibration-resistant mountings are specified to cope with uneven surfaces and exposed hill winds.

Outcome is a space-efficient bed with organised under-bed storage and insulation selected for cooler, exposed nights. Remote drop-off or tight-access sites may need pre-arranged staging; full commissioning is done from the Lincoln workshop with installation notes for countryside use.

Laws vary locally. Sleeping in a vehicle on private land needs permission; public roads and laybys are often allowed but check local bylaws and landowner rules before parking overnight.
It is not universally illegal, but local councils and landowners may set restrictions. Always check signage, local bylaws and obtain permission for private land.
Unchecked condensation encourages mould and rot, which can ruin mattresses and timber. Early ventilation fixes and breathable bases avoid replacement costs and health risks.
Layby rules differ by council. Short rest stops are usually tolerated, but overnight stays can be restricted. Check local signage and avoid blocking access or farm entrances.
